When people are diagnosed with schizophrenia, it’s usually after they experience a psychotic break. But the disease starts before that -- maybe long before. Now, there’s a promising new treatment that seeks to prevent a psychotic symptoms like hearing voices and delusional thinking, by identifying young people at risk of developing the disease and treating them preventatively.
